I need to have a "DW_LANG_* to string" function for a change I'm making
in binutils-gdb.  I'm sending this patch to gcc first, once merged I'll
sync it to binutils-gdb.

  - move the "DW_LANG_*" definitions from dwarf2.h to dwarf2.def
  - add the necessary macros in dwarf2.h to generate the enumeration
  - add the necessary macros in dwarfnames.c to generate the "to string"
    function
